易语言编程基础教程
版权申诉
40 浏览量
更新于2024-10-23
收藏 1.33MB ZIP 举报
资源摘要信息:"易语言是一种简单易学的编程语言,特别适合初学者入门。易语言的开发环境提供了丰富的函数库和组件,使得编程变得简单。本资源中的'易语言入门基础.doc'文件详细介绍了易语言的基础知识和基本操作,帮助初学者快速掌握易语言的基本用法。
1. 易语言的历史和特点
易语言自1999年由中国大陆的吴涛先生开发,其最大的特点是使用中文作为编程语言,将复杂的英文编程语句转化为中文,大大降低了编程的门槛。易语言支持面向对象编程、事件驱动编程等多种编程范式,并且具备良好的中文API文档。
2. 易语言的开发环境
易语言的集成开发环境(IDE)提供了代码编辑、调试、编译和运行等功能,它支持拖放组件设计界面,使得界面设计直观且便捷。在开发环境中,用户可以自定义代码模板,提高编码效率。
3. 易语言的基本语法
易语言的基本语法包括变量定义、数据类型、运算符、控制流程等。变量可以存储不同类型的数据,如整数、浮点数、字符串和数组等。易语言的控制流程涵盖了条件判断和循环控制结构,比如IF语句和FOR循环等。
4. 易语言的函数和模块
易语言拥有大量的内置函数,从字符串处理到文件操作,再到更复杂的界面绘制和网络通信,函数库覆盖了编程的方方面面。模块化编程允许用户将代码封装成模块,在不同的程序中重复使用,提高代码复用率。
5. 易语言的错误处理和调试
在程序开发过程中,错误处理和调试是不可或缺的环节。易语言支持try...catch异常处理结构,便于捕捉和处理运行时的错误。调试工具包括断点、单步执行和变量监视等,有助于开发者定位问题所在。
6. 易语言的界面设计和窗口控件
易语言提供了直观的窗口设计器,用户可以像搭积木一样拖动控件并设置属性。控件包括按钮、文本框、列表框等,支持自定义控件和事件处理,能够设计出丰富多彩的用户界面。
7. 易语言的文件操作和数据库管理
易语言对于文件的操作提供了丰富的方法,包括文件的创建、读写、删除等。此外,易语言还支持多种数据库系统的操作,比如SQLite、MySQL等,为数据存储和管理提供了便利。
8. 易语言的网络编程
网络通信是现代软件中不可或缺的部分。易语言提供了诸如TCP/IP通信、HTTP协议交互等网络编程的支持,允许开发者创建网络客户端和服务器端应用。
9. 易语言的多媒体处理
易语言还可以进行简单的多媒体处理,如播放音乐、控制音量、显示图片等。这使得开发游戏或者媒体相关的应用变得更加容易。
通过本资源的学习,初学者可以逐步熟悉易语言的开发环境,掌握基本的编程知识,为进一步深入学习编程语言和开发技能打下坚实的基础。"
2019-02-08 上传
2023-09-16 上传
2023-01-06 上传
2023-01-06 上传
2022-07-14 上传
2023-04-07 上传
2012-11-24 上传
2024-11-28 上传
2021-12-07 上传
beyondwild
- 粉丝: 9953
- 资源: 4916
最新资源
- async-websocket:异步WebSocket客户端和服务器,支持Ruby的HTTP1和HTTP2
- SAWD-maker:句法注释的Wikipedia转储的源代码
- scheduler
- 学习网页包
- CephEWS:Ceph预警系统
- wmrss-开源
- triwow
- TabMail-开源
- thinreports-examples:Thinreports的代码示例
- Hello-world-C-:经典程序介绍,在控制台上的消息发送到控制台
- gatsby-pwa-demo:PWA示例:使用Gatsby.js的渐进式Web App电子商务
- vtprint-开源
- CISSP认证考试必过核心笔记精简版.rar
- Easy_Align_Addon:对齐Blender 2.78的插件
- Python二级等级考试电子教案(1-11章)合集(含行文代码).zip
- FibonacciHeap:Fibonacci堆实现